Mayor optimistic for Auxiliary police
Dumaguete City Mayor Agustin Perdices is optimistic that the city council will finally pass a resolution to create an auxiliary police in the city.
According to the mayor, the creation of a police auxiliary will greatly help in augmenting police personnel shortage. However, the mayor disclosed that unlike what is done in Bayawan City, Dumaguete will not issue high caliber firearms to police auxiliary since they will only give assistance to police personnel. The police will still do the operations and these auxiliary police will not be used to fight against insurgency problems.
Members of the city council will still go to Bayawan city to conduct a ‘lakbay aral’ so that they may personally assess and witness the newly created police auxiliary.
On the other hand, the city mayor assured the police officials in the city under Supt Dionardo Carlos that the city government will give an additional support for the mobility and communication of the police during their operations. Evidently, the city government has just turned over handheld radios to the city police.
Meanwhile, the city government is ready to give a repeater to the city police if they ask for it.
